Refined Soybean Oil: A Deep Investigation into Production & Properties

The production of refined soybean oil is a intricate process, starting with reaped soybeans. These beans are first cleaned and then split to remove the hulls. Next, the soybean flakes are flaked to release the oil, a method often involving solvent removal . The raw oil then undergoes a series of purification stages, including degumming, neutralization, bleaching, and deodorization, to remove impurities and enhance its hue, flavor , and longevity. This results in a light yellow liquid with a neutral flavor, prized for its substantial oleic acid content and versatility in food preparation. Its characteristics include a high smoke point and a relatively small saturated fat proportion , making it a prevalent choice for buyers globally.
